STOCKTON, Calif. - The Pacific field hockey team capped off their regular season home schedule with a huge win over America East rival, UC Davis, 5-1. Senior Savannah Burns scored two goals and collected an assist, while Rylee Comeau, Gaby de Kock and Hayley Kilfoil each recorded a goal.
The win brings the Tigers to 8-7 overall and 4-2 in the America East, while the loss drops the Aggies to 1-15 overall and 0-5 in the conference.
On senior day, Pacific completely controlled the game from the beginning as the Tigers registered 19 shots in the first half to Davis' four.
